Tornado-Producing Storm Deals Deadly Weather to Oklahoma and Texas
A slow-moving, active storm system brought heavy rain, large hail and tornadoes to parts of Texas and Oklahoma and left three people dead as severe weather warnings Sunday continue to threaten parts of the south-central and Midwest U.S. On Easter Sunday, communities in Texas and Oklahoma were beginning to assess the damage wreaked by tornadoes. Commentary: Addressing Valley flooding
The Rio Grande Valley is still reeling from historic storms that hit our region in March, leaving in its wake a devastating loss of four lives and untold property damages that could surpass $100 million. As I write this, some communities are still underwater.
